Yes, there is a starter relay under the seat pan. You'd need a parts diagram to locate it, and there's lots available on line.  First check the starter by jumping directly from the battery to the starter 12v lug. Then you'll know if it's the starter or the relay. Or the switch!

JJJoseph - I found & tested the starter relay/solenoid under the seat and found it defective (by jumping it)  it starts and runs great.  It has that "NEW" engine smell, with only 40 miles on it I guess t should!! Thanks for the direction!!!!

I just purchased a 2012 Yeager 200i with 40 miles on the odometer. This scooter is new, I bought it from a friend who bought it for his wife. Long story - short, he sold it to me as she got vertigo and never drove it. Problem is it won't start. All gauges work, lights, horn, turn signals, etc. Battery was dead, so I put a new battery in it. Won't crank. Followed starting process - kick stand up, turn key on, turn switch on, hold rear brake and push starter button  - NOTHING.
     I helped him bring it home back in 2012 and even rode it around as they never rode a scooter before, so I know it ran. It has sat in the same spot in his garage with a new cover on it for 10 years.     I rechecked my startup procedure and even bypassed the kickstand safety switch by placing a fuse in the 1st slot in the fuse box. Still nothing. Is there a starter relay/solenoid that I can check? Any ideas?
